Description:
Supplements the learning in other nursing courses by providing the sophomore nursing student with global concepts of the professional registered nurse and responsibilities of the graduate of the Associate degree program. This course includes lecture and discussion on such topics as the definition of nursing, nursing as a profession, ethical/legal consideration, nursing theory, and current trends affecting nursing practices Reviews requirements for R.N. licensure application, responsibilities for triennial registration, and limited work permit filing in New York State. Focuses on role of the nurse as member within the discipline of nursing Successful completion of NUR 101 and concurrent enrollment in NUR 202 or NUR 203 and NUR 204. B
